Takarouit N’Charah
Takarouit N’Charah is a hill in Béjaia Province, Algeria and has an elevation of 427 metres. Takarouit N’Charah is situated nearby to the locality Taranimt, as well as near Tigoudiouine.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Toudja is a commune in northern Algeria in the Béjaïa Province in the Kabylia region. The liberal pied noir writer Jules Roy discussed it in his book on the Algerian war of independence. Toudja is situated 6 km southwest of Takarouit N’Charah.
